Understanding Peak Seasons: When Demand Drives Up the Cost

The popularity of Triyuginarayan as a wedding destination has defined clear peak seasons when demand for services is at its highest, consequently impacting the overall Triyuginarayan wedding cost.

  • Spring/Early Summer (April to June): This period is highly sought after. The weather is generally pleasant, with clear skies, comfortable temperatures (ranging from 10°C to 25°C), and blooming natural beauty. Roads are fully accessible, making travel smooth for guests. The vibrant environment is ideal for capturing stunning wedding photographs against a backdrop of lush greenery.
  • Autumn (September to November): Following the monsoon, this season offers crisp, clean air, clear blue skies, and comfortable temperatures (around 8°C to 20°C). The post-monsoon greenery is vibrant, and the air is free from humidity, providing excellent visibility of the majestic Himalayan ranges. This period is also popular for various pilgrimages, further increasing demand for accommodation and services.


Why Costs Rise During Peak Season:

During these periods, all wedding-related services from accommodation and transportation to decorators and photographers are in high demand. This leads to:

  • Higher Accommodation Rates: Hotels and guesthouses in nearby areas (like Guptkashi and Sonprayag) often implement surge pricing.
  • Limited Availability: Key vendors and preferred accommodation might be fully booked months in advance, reducing your options and flexibility.
  • Increased Travel Costs: Flights, trains, and taxis to the region might be more expensive due to general tourist and pilgrim traffic.
  • While the peak seasons offer ideal weather and seamless logistics, they undeniably come with a higher Triyuginarayan wedding cost.

Exploring Off-Seasons: Potential Savings vs. Practical Challenges

Venturing into the off-season can offer significant savings, but it's crucial to understand the unique challenges associated with each period.

  • Monsoon (July to August): This is generally considered the most challenging time for a Triyuginarayan Temple wedding.
  • Cost Implications: Prices for packages, accommodation, and local services are typically at their lowest due to very minimal demand.
  • Practical Challenges: Heavy rainfall frequently leads to landslides, road blockages, and unsafe travel conditions. The weather can be unpredictable, making outdoor ceremonies difficult and potentially disrupting travel plans for guests. The views might be obscured by clouds and fog.
  • Experience Focus: Suitable only for highly adventurous couples prioritizing extreme budget savings and comfortable with significant travel risks and potential disruptions.
  • Winter (December to March): This season transforms the region into a snowy wonderland, offering a uniquely mystical ambiance.
  • Cost Implications: Prices are generally lower than peak season, especially in January and February, making it a viable option for a budget-conscious Triyuginarayan wedding cost.
  • Practical Challenges: Temperatures drop significantly (often below freezing, with snowfall). Roads can become impassable, particularly to Triyuginarayan village itself, requiring alternative arrangements (like staying further down in the valley and potentially a longer trek or using ponies/palanquins even for shorter distances). Heating arrangements for guests are crucial, and service availability might be limited.
  • Experience Focus: Ideal for couples dreaming of a serene, intimate ceremony amidst snow-dusted peaks, who are prepared for cold weather and potential logistical hurdles. It offers a truly unique, picturesque, and less crowded experience.

Strategic Planning: Maximizing Value for Your Triyuginarayan Wedding Cost

Choosing the right season requires a balance of budget, desired ambiance, and guest comfort.

  1. Evaluate Your Priorities: If a seamless experience with perfect weather and stunning views is paramount, a peak-season wedding might be worth the higher Triyuginarayan wedding cost. If significant savings are the goal, and you're adaptable to challenges, consider the edges of the off-season or even a winter wedding.
  2. Flexible Dates: If your dates are flexible, aim for the shoulder seasons (e.g., late March/early April or late November/early December). These periods often offer milder weather than deep winter/monsoon, with potentially lower costs and fewer crowds than peak months.
  3. Guest Comfort: Consider your guests. Elderly relatives or those unaccustomed to mountain travel might struggle during extreme weather conditions of the off-season.
  4. Early Booking (Always!): Regardless of the season, booking your Triyuginarayan Temple wedding services and accommodation well in advance is crucial. This not only secures your preferred dates and vendors but can also lock in rates before potential increases.
  5. Leverage Wedding Planners: Specialized wedding planners for Triyuginarayan have deep knowledge of seasonal fluctuations, local conditions, and vendor availability. They can help you navigate the complexities, secure the best possible rates, and build contingency plans for off-season weddings, ensuring transparency in your Triyuginarayan wedding cost.
